Output edc87863c3c614e1ae07f8de7b049ec0093f6431ca027ff5bd579231b64dfc3b:0

value
38963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f94b934ec03b7967acd31e4e3e3d90404cf717 OP_EQUAL
address
3BzNFN4yEde72wopEN5udAhXLLaqsDFanm
transaction
edc87863c3c614e1ae07f8de7b049ec0093f6431ca027ff5bd579231b64dfc3b
spent
false